**Affirmed position.** SoK: Attacks on DAOs should be assessed against Kaal's source-bound claim that A DAO built on reputation rather than a fungible token, as CRDAO is, makes the 51 percent attack nearly impossible and renders sock puppet attacks technically possible but of little influence. The current metadata indicates a plausible connection through decentralized autonomous organization, but the defensible response is a qualification until the source text confirms agreement, scope, methods, and limitations.
